The Masters of Dental Implantology Program (10 Credit Hours)
If you’re a dental professional looking to expand your knowledge and skills in dental implantology, The Masters of Dental Implantology Program (10 Credit Hours) provides an excellent opportunity to enhance your expertise in full arch implant rehabilitation, treatment planning, and construction. You’ll learn from renowned dental implant experts, including Prof. Dr. Salah Hegazy, Prof. Dr. Ehab Rashed, Prof. Dr. Ahmed Barkat, Prof. Dr. Ashraf Fathy, and Prof. Dr. Ahmed Othman. The program covers a range of topics, including the anatomy of the maxillary sinus, implant prosthodontic classification, and implant selection and timing.
